Boost Your Python Programming Skills with the Map Function

Python is a versatile and powerful programming language that is widely used in various fields such as web development, data analysis, artificial intelligence, and more. If you are looking to improve your Python programming skills, one way to do so is by mastering the map function.

The map function in Python is a built-in function that allows you to apply a specific function to each element in an iterable (such as a list, tuple, or dictionary) and return a new iterable with the transformed elements. This can be incredibly useful for simplifying your code and making it more efficient.

One of the key benefits of using the map function is that it allows you to write more concise and readable code. Instead of writing a loop to iterate over each element in a list and apply a function to it, you can simply use the map function to achieve the same result in a single line of code. This can help you write cleaner and more maintainable code.

Another advantage of using the map function is that it can help you improve the performance of your code. By using the map function, you can take advantage of the built-in optimizations that Python provides for processing iterables, which can lead to faster execution times compared to using a loop.

Additionally, the map function can also help you write more functional-style code in Python. Functional programming is a programming paradigm that emphasizes the use of functions as first-class citizens, and the map function is a key tool in functional programming for transforming data.

To use the map function, you simply need to pass in the function you want to apply to each element in the iterable, along with the iterable itself. Here is a simple example to demonstrate how the map function works:

“` python

# Define a function to square a number

def square(x):

return x**2

# Create a list of numbers

numbers = [1, 2, 3, 4, 5]

# Use the map function to square each number in the list

squared_numbers = map(square, numbers)

# Convert the map object to a list

squared_numbers_list = list(squared_numbers)

print(squared_numbers_list)

“`

In this example, the square function is applied to each element in the numbers list using the map function, resulting in a new list of squared numbers. This demonstrates how the map function can be used to apply a function to each element in an iterable and return a new iterable with the transformed elements.
